Best Seasons for Offsites
- Spring (March to May): Mild weather, ideal for outdoor activities.
- Fall (September to November): Beautiful foliage and comfortable temperatures.
- Note: Summer can be hot and humid, while winter may bring unpredictable weather.
Getting There
- Airport: Nashville International Airport (BNA) is approximately 15 minutes from downtown.
- Transportation: Most venues offer shuttle services, making logistics easier for your team.

Budget Breakdown for a 30-Person Offsite
| Category | Cost Estimate | Percentage Allocation | |-------------------|------------------|-----------------------| | Venue | $4,500 - $7,500 | 40% | | Food & Beverage | $2,250 - $3,750 | 25% | | Activities | $1,500 - $2,250 | 15% | | Travel | $1,500 - $2,250 | 15% | | Contingency | $500 - $750 | 5% | | Total | $10,250 - $16,500 | 100% |
Timeline for Planning Your Offsite
60 Days Out
- Week 1: Define objectives, budget, and dates.
- Week 2: Research and shortlist venues; start contacting for availability.
45 Days Out
- Week 3: Finalize venue; book accommodations and confirm F&B options.
- Week 4: Plan activities; send invites to team members.
30 Days Out
- Week 5: Confirm all vendor details; finalize the agenda.
- Week 6: Conduct a risk assessment; prepare for any contingencies.
15 Days Out
- Week 7: Confirm headcount; finalize transportation details.
- Week 8: Prepare offsite materials (e.g., presentations, swag).
1 Week Before
- Final Checks: Confirm all bookings and send reminders to attendees.
Risk Mitigation
- Venue Issues: Have a backup venue in mind, just in case.
- Weather Concerns: Plan indoor activities as alternatives.
- Travel Delays: Encourage team members to arrive a day early, if possible.
